Broadband Stimulus funded FTTH upgrade delivers cutting edge
communications and entertainment services for rural businesses and
residents
HUNTSVILLE, Ala.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--May. 6, 2013--
ADTRAN®,
Inc. (NASDAQ:ADTN), a leading provider of next-generation networking
solutions, today announced that its industry leading Total Access
broadband portfolio is providing the infrastructure foundation for
Sycamore Telephone Company’s (STC) $4.1M Fiber-to-the-Home (FTTH)
broadband upgrade. With the Broadband Stimulus funded project, Sycamore
Telephone is offering cutting edge communication and entertainment
services to 4,200 rural residents, 450 local business and 14 community
anchor institutions in the area. ADTRAN’s innovative FTTH solutions
provide Sycamore with the maximum operational flexibility, leading
service density and virtually unlimited network bandwidth. As a result,
Sycamore has deployed the most modern next generation network in the
area, outpacing nearby, larger cities, in Northern Ohio.
ADTRAN’s FTTH portfolio, including the Total Access 5000 and Total
Access 300 series, offers the industry’s most comprehensive set of
broadband solutions from an all-Ethernet platform. By choosing ADTRAN’s
FTTH portfolio, Sycamore is able to deploy a high-capacity fiber access
network that easily scales to handle the most bandwidth intensive
services, including IPTV, Voice over IP (VoIP) and high-speed Internet
at ultra-broadband speeds. As a result, Sycamore can ensure that its
rural residents and businesses have the technology infrastructure that
they need to attract new jobs, health care and educational opportunities
to their local community.

About Sycamore Telephone Company
Founded in 1896, Sycamore Telephone Company is a full service
telecommunications company operating in Sycamore, Ohio. Sycamore offers
residential and business communication services in Seneca, Wyandot and
Crawford counties to over 2,000 customers with a focus on excellent
customer service, innovative products, teamwork and community
involvement.
